如何在 Python 中检查两个日期时间之间是否已经过去 24 小时?
Dec 02, 2024 pm 03:16 PM如何确定 Python 中的日期时间之间是否已过去 24 小时
确定两个日期时间之间是否已过去 24 小时是一个常见任务编程。提供的方法 time_diff 计算上次执行时间 (last_updated) 与 24 小时后的一天时间之间的时间差。然而,要确定是否已经过了 24 小时,需要采取进一步措施。以下是一些方法:
1.朴素日期时间比较(UTC)
如果last_updated表示UTC中的朴素日期时间(没有时区信息),您可以使用日期时间模块:
1 2 3 4 |
|
2。 Naive Datetime Comparison (Local Time)
如果last_updated代表当地时间,你可以使用time模块:
1 2 3 4 5 6 7 |
|
3.感知日期时间比较(时区感知)
如果last_updated是时区感知日期时间,您可以将其转换为UTC并与当前UTC时间进行比较:
1 2 3 4 5 |
|
4.使用 tzlocal 模块
tzlocal 模块可用于处理原始日期时间的时区转换:
1 2 3 4 5 6 7 |
|
以上是如何在 Python 中检查两个日期时间之间是否已经过去 24 小时?的详细内容。更多信息请关注PHP中文网其他相关文章!

热门文章

热门文章

热门文章标签

记事本++7.3.1
好用且免费的代码编辑器

SublimeText3汉化版
中文版,非常好用

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 Mac版
神级代码编辑软件(SublimeText3)